Each connectivity map entry has three possible components:

1. Status Notification. This object is located at the top of the page, it contains a short, color-coded descriptor regarding the overall status of the entire entry. There are four possible states: Alpha, Beta, Intermediate, and Final (light to dark respectively); although the descriptors are a little more descriptive than that.

2. Entry notes. When available, this object is located directly below the Status Notification and includes a verbose behind-the-scenes analysis of the entry. While most entries are comprehensive enough, sometimes I like to provide a little extra context, explain my thought process, or describe in detail specific problems that needed to be solved for the entry to evolve. Notes are not necessary to understand the entry, they are just an insight bonus.

3. Entry. The entries are located directly below the notes, if there are no notes, then below the status notification. Four progressive, color-coded layers, or 'versions' of the subject form a visual 'history' that is arranged vertically. Initially the lightest (bottom) "alpha" layer is populated with a sketchy and often speculative outline. Next the "beta" layer is populated with a more refined version that still contains a degree of uncertainty. Then the "intermediate" layer which is essentially complete except for possible conflicts with other external entries, and lastly the "final" and darkest (top) layer is filled in, which represents what is effectively the last word on the subject.
